一种后向流量管控系统的制作方法

文档序号:9380215阅读:252来源:国知局
一种后向流量管控系统的制作方法
【技术领域】
[0001] 本发明涉及一种网络技术,具体涉及一种后向流量管控系统。
【背景技术】
[0002] 当前,随着手机等移动终端的普及以及移动互联网的蓬勃发展,移动终端用户对 移动数据流量的使用量日益增多,因而传统的由终端用户为流量付费的前向付费模式成为 了制约移动互联网行业发展最大的瓶颈。于是,出现了一种由内容提供商(例如移动互联 网公司)为后向流量向电信运营商(例如中国联通)付费而终端用户免费的后向流量付费模 式。内容提供商在产品(例如app)推广和应用过程中为解决用户使用该产品过程中产生的 流量费用顾虑和增加体验满意度,通常对用户使用相关产品所消耗的数据流量采用后向流 量付费模式。后向流量付费模式具有不需终端用户为使用相应的产品所消耗的流量支付费 用等优点,因而具有广阔的应用前景。
[0003] 无论前向流量、后向流量或者定向流量都是网络传输协议过程中,对无线网络数 据的管控和代理。电信运营商服务器需要在各种网络数据中识别哪些是普通流量数据,哪 些是需要管控和统计的流量数据,以便针对不用类型的网络数据(前向、后向、定向和非定 向等)选择不同的处理方式。而在后向流量付费模式中,需要解决的一个重要问题就是对后 向流量进行准确统计,以在内容提供商与电信运营商之间进行流量费用结算。
[0004] 现有的后向流量统计方法包括两种,其中第一种方法为通过对预先注册流量来源 的内容提供商服务器的IP进行管控来统计后向流量,第二种方法为通过解析客户端和服 务器交互的标准网络通信协议来统计后向流量。第一种后向流量统计方法的原理如图1所 示,该方法是在内容提供商服务器端通过访问IP地址来识别用户身份信息,技术实现方式 是将内容提供商服务器的IP地址事先注册在电信运营商服务器系统内,对来自这些已注 册IP的数据进行后向流量数据处理,然后通过各个IP的流量数据统计出某个内容提供商 所使用的数据流量。该方法通过硬件IP地址解析,统计功能不灵活且不能细化统计,只能 统计到每个IP地址或者内容提供商服务器端口的使用量,无法提供访问该服务器的具体 用户的数据流量信息,更无法管控具体用户的阈值等。即,该方法无法统计出每个移动终端 用户(实际用户)的后向流量,只能统计出内容提供商的后向数据流量。
[0005] 第二种后向流量统计方法的原理如图2所示,该方法通过电信运营商服务器和内 容提供商服务器直接传输的特殊网络传输协议区分实际用户的身份和使用的流量,这样就 不必事先把所有内容提供商服务器的IP地址都注册再提供后向流量服务。使用这种方法 的硬件设备投入相比前一类少很多,统计和服务也可以细化到每个实际用户,统计出每个 终端用户的后向流量。但是,该方法无法统计内容提供商服务器的后向流量数据。此外,由 于该方法所采用的标准网络通信协议都遵守"ISO"和"中国通信标准化协会(CCSA)制定的 标准为通信行业标准",应用软件最常使用的是HTTP和TCP/IP协议族,网络流量代理使用 的是Socks协议族,这些协议在传输过程中容易被破解或者串改,存在安全隐患。
[0006] 因此,为解决现有的后向流量统计方法所存在的上述技术问题,有必要提出一种 新的后向流量管控系统。

【发明内容】

[0007] 针对现有技术的不足,本发明提供一种后向流量管控系统,该系统包括: 内容提供商流量统计模块,用于对内容提供商服务器的后向流量进行统计; 终端流量统计模块,用于对用户终端的后向流量进行统计; 流量统计控制模块,用于对后向流量的统计模式进行控制,其中所述统计模式包括:仅 开启所述内容提供商流量统计模块、仅开启所述终端流量统计模块、以及同时开启所述内 容提供商流量统计模块和所述终端流量统计模块。
[0008] 示例性地,所述内容提供商流量统计模块包括: IP地址识别单元,用于对内容提供商服务器的IP地址信息进行识别; 服务器信息识别单元,用于根据所述IP地址信息对内容提供商服务器进行识别; 第一后向流量统计单元,用于对经识别的内容提供商服务器的后向流量进行统计并输 出统计结果。
[0009] 示例性地,所述终端流量统计模块包括: 传输协议识别单元,用于对产生后向流量的传输协议进行识别; 终端信息识别单元,用于根据所识别的传输协议对相应的用户终端进行识别; 第二后向流量统计单元,用于对经识别的用户终端的后向流量进行统计并输出统计结 果。
[0010] 示例性地,所述内容提供商流量统计模块、所述终端流量统计模块以及所述流量 统计控制模块由软件实现、或由硬件实现、或由硬件结合软件实现。
[0011] 示例性地,所述系统还包括: 网络监控模块,用于对网络运行情况进行监控;和/或, 安全控制模块,用于对数据传输的安全性进行管控。
[0012] 示例性地,所述网络监控模块包括: 网络状况监控单元,用于对网络是否正常运行进行监控并在出现网络异常时进行报 警; 流量阈值监控单元,用于对各个内容提供商服务器和/或用户终端的后向流量使用情 况进行阈值监控和提醒。
[0013] 示例性地,所述网络监控模块还包括: 特殊信息监控单元,用于对非法信息以及黑名单信息进行监控和处理。
[0014] 示例性地,所述安全控制模块包括: 协议版本管控单元,用于对传输协议进行版本升级和维护; 加密方式管控单元,用于对数据的加密方式进行管理; 密钥和签名管控单元,用于对密钥和签名进行管控。
[0015] 示例性地,所述终端流量统计模块利用后向流量传输协议对用户终端的后向流量 进行统计,其中所述后向流量传输协议包括: 协议账户和类型,用于通过账户信息对各用户终端进行区分; 协议加密/密钥/签名,用于对数据传输进行安全性管控; 协议扩展性信息,用于在传输的数据中附加特殊用途的信息。
[0016] 示例性地,所述系统利用所述后向流量传输协议进行数据传输,其中数据传输的 过程包括: 步骤Sl :头信息相互识别; 步骤S2 :在头信息相互识别成功后,交换密钥和验证帐号进行认证; 步骤S3 :传输正式的网络数据协议。
[0017] 本发明的后向流量管控系统由于包括内容提供商流量统计模块、终端流量统计模 块和流量统计控制模块,因而可以实现对用户终端的后向流量以及内容提供商服务器的后 向流量的灵活统计,该系统综合了现存技术中两种后向流量统计方法的优点。
【附图说明】
[0018] 本发明的下列附图在此作为本发明的一部分用于理解本发明。附图中示出了本发 明的实施例及其描述,用来解释本发明的原理。
[0019] 附图中: 图1为现有的一种后向流量统计方法的示意图; 图2为现有的另一种后向流量统计方法的示意图; 图3为本发明的一个实施例的一种后向流量管控系统的示意图; 图4为本发明的一个实施例的一种后向流量管控系统的结构框图。
[0020]
【具体实施方式】
[0021] 在下文的描述中,给出了大量具体的细节以便提供对本发明更为彻底的理解。然 而,对于本领域技术人员而言显而易见的是,本发明可以无需一个或多个这些细节而得以 实施。在其他的例子中,为了避免与本发明发生混淆,对于本领域公知的一些技术特征未进 行描述。
[0022] 应当理解的是,本发明能够以不同形式实施,而不应当解释为局限于这里提出的 实施例。相反地,提供这些实施例将使公开彻底和完全,并且将本发明的范围完全地传递给 本领域技术人员。
[0023] 在此使用的术语的目的仅在于描述具体实施例并且不作为本发明的限制。在此使 用时,单数形式的"一"、"一个"和"所述/该"也意图包括复数形式,除非上下文清楚指出 另外的方式。还应明白术语"组成"和/或"包括",当在该说明书中使用时,确定所述特征、 整数、步骤、操作、元件和/或部件的存在,但不排除一个或更多其它的特征、整数、步骤、操 作、元件、部件和/或组的存在或添加。在此使用时,术语"和/或"包括相关所列项目的任 何及所有组合。
[0024] 除非另外定义,在此使用的所有术语(包括技术和科学术语)具有与本发明领域 的普通技术人员所通常理解的相同的含义。还应当理解,诸如普通使用的字典中所定义的 术语应当理解为具有与它们在相关领域和/或本规格书的环境中的含义一致的含义,而不 能在理想的或过度正式的意义上解释,除非这里明示地这样定义。
[0025
当前第1页1 2 3 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1